Fish Bouillabaisse

Food Ingredients:
1 teaspoon saffron threads 1 cup white wine Grated zest and juice of 1 orange 1 lrg onion chopped 2 garlic cloves minced 2 tablespoons olive oil 2 celery ribs chopped 1 teaspoon ground fennel seed 1 teaspoon dried basil 1 teaspoon thyme 1 bay leaf 12 ripe plum tomatoes skinned, seeded, and chopped 3 cups Quick Fish Stock (see recipe) Salt and Pepper to taste 1 pound fatty fish fillet (tuna, cut into chunks 1 pound lean fish fillet (cod, cut into chunks 1/4 cup chopped parsley

Recipe preparation:
1 In small bowl, mix saffron, wine, orange zest and juice; set aside. 2 In soup pot, saute onion and garlic in oil to barely soft. Add celery; cook one minute. Stir in fennel seed, basil, thyme and bay leaf. Add reserved wine mixture; bring to a boil for two minutes. Add tomatoes and fish stock. Return to a boil; reduce to a simmer for 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. 3 Add fatty fish; simmer one minute. Add lean fish; simmer four minutes more. Stir in parsley; simmer one minute more. 4 This recipe yields 4 to 6 servings.
